Rocket Launch NewsUnited States Rocket Launch CentersNASA's Johnson Space Center in Houston, TXThe Johnson Space Center (JSC), located in Houston, Texas, is a crucial hub for NASA's human spaceflight programs. Named after President Lyndon B. Johnson, it was established in 1961 and has been at the forefront of space exploration ever since. JSC houses Mission Control, which manages all crewed space missions, including Space Shuttle flights, and the International Space Station (ISS) operations. The center is home to astronaut training facilities, including the Neutral Buoyancy Lab supports a massive pool used to simulate weightlessness and advanced simulators that prepare astronauts for the challenges of space. JSC also engages in cutting-edge research, developing technologies for future missions to Mars and beyond. Educational and public outreach are central to JSC's mission. The Space Center Houston visitor complex offers interactive exhibits, tours, and programs that inspire the next generation of explorers. The center collaborates with universities and industries to advance space science and technology. European Space AgencyGuiana Space Center ZLV, Kourou, French GuianaThe Guiana Space Center is a facility used by the European Space Agency (ESA) and the French government to launch satellites into space. The ESA contributes two-thirds of the spaceport's annual budget and the spaceport has also been used for launches for the United States, Japan, Canada, India and Brazil, among other countries. Russian Space AgencyVostochny Cosmodrome, RussiaOperated by Russian Space Agency, this is a Russian spaceport above the 51st parallel north in the Amur Oblast, in the Russian Far East. It is intended to reduce Russia 's dependency on the Baikonur Cosmodrome in Kazakhstan. Since its inception, there have been numerous launches from this spaceport. It is intended that the majority of launches will be moved from Baikonur to this location. The nearby train station is Ledyanaya and the nearest city is Tsiolkovsky. Baikonur Cosmodrome, Kazakhstan (Russian)Operated by Russian Space Agency, this is the launch site for the majority of Soyuz rockets that carry all manned cosmonauts capsules and many supply to the International Space Station (ISS.) Russia will lease this site from Kazakhstan until 2050, but the Russians want to move most of the launch activity to Russia over the next few years. Star City, RussiaTraining center for Russian Cosmonauts and the center of an important television series about the early Russian efforts in the space race. Located in a forest outsite of Moscow, the site was kept secret until a few years ago. China National Space AdministrationChina’s space program, led by the China National Space Administration (CNSA), has achieved significant milestones in lunar exploration. One of the most notable achievements is the successful landing of the Chang e-4 mission on the far side of the moon on January 3, 2019. This mission marked the first time any spacecraft had landed on the moon’s far side, a region that presents unique challenges due to its rugged terrain and lack of direct communication with Earth. Building on this success, China continued its lunar exploration with the Chan e-5 mission, which successfully returned lunar samples to Earth in December 20202. This mission was the first to bring back lunar samples since the 1970s, providing valuable scientific data about the moon's composition and history. In 2024, China landed in the South Pole-Aitken Basin, the largest impact basin on the moon. This mission aimed to collect samples from the far side of the moon, a feat that had never been accomplished before. China's lunar exploration program is part of a broader strategy to establish a sustainable human presence on the moon. The CNSA has announced plans to build a lunar research station near the moon's south pole by the 2030s. China Wenchang Launch CenterThe Wenchang Space Launch Center is located in Wenchang on the island of Hainan, China. It serves as China's fourth and southernmost spaceport, a launch facility capable of launching spacecraft. This location is notable for being China's first commercial space launch facility, designed to support the growing demand for commercial satellite launches and other space missions. Construction of the Wenchang Commercial Space Launch Site began in July 2022, and the first launch complex was completed by the end of 2023. The space center features two launch pads, with the second pad expected to be operational by the third quarter of 2024. This center is equipped to handle a variety of rockets, including the Long March 8, Long March 8A, and future rockets like the Long March 12 and Tianlong-31. The Wenchang center is strategically located near the equator, which provides an advantage for launching payloads into geostationary and other orbits. This location allows rockets to take full advantage of the Earth's rotational speed, making launches more efficient and cost-effective. The development of the Wenchang Commercial Space Launch Site is expected to play a crucial role in China's future space missions, including satellite launches, deep space exploration, and potentially crewed missions. India's Space ProgramSatish Dhawan Space Center, Sriharikota, IndiaThe Satish Dhawan Space Center (SDSC), also known as Sriharikota Range (SHAR), is India's primary spaceport located in Sriharikota, Andhra Pradesh. Named after the former chairman of the Indian Space Research Organisation (ISRO), Satish Dhawan, it is the launch site for India's most ambitious space missions. The facility, operational since 1971, includes multiple launch pads and extensive support infrastructure. SDSC plays a pivotal role in the launch of both satellites and manned missions, including the notable Chandrayaan and Mangalyaan missions. It symbolizes India's growing capabilities in space exploration and satellite technology. India’s space program, led by the Indian Space Research Organisation (ISRO), has made remarkable strides since its inception in 1969. Established to harness space technology for national development, ISRO has grown into a major player in global space exploration. One of ISRO’s early milestones was the launch of Aryabhata, India’s first satellite, in 1975. This achievement marked India’s entry into the space age1. Over the years, ISRO has developed a series of successful launch vehicles, including the Polar Satellite Launch Vehicle (PSLV) and the Geosynchronous Satellite Launch Vehicle (GSLV), which have been instrumental in deploying satellites for various purposes, from communication to earth observation. ISRO’s Chandrayaan missions have been particularly noteworthy. Chandrayaan-1, launched in 2008, was India’s first lunar probe and made significant discoveries, including evidence of water molecules on the moon. Building on this success, Chandrayaan-2 aimed to explore the moon’s south pole, although its lander faced challenges during descent. The upcoming Chandrayaan-3 mission aims to achieve a successful soft landing on the lunar surface. In addition to lunar exploration, ISRO has also ventured into interplanetary missions. The Mars Orbiter Mission (Mangalyaan), launched in 2013, made India the first Asian nation to reach Mars orbit and the fourth space agency globally to do so. This mission demonstrated ISRO’s capability in cost-effective space exploration. Looking ahead, ISRO has ambitious plans, including the Gaganyaan mission, which aims to send Indian astronauts into space, and the Aditya-L1 mission to study the sun. Japan's Space ProgramJapan Aerospace Exploration Agency, Tsukuba, Ibaraki, JapanJapan’s space program, spearheaded by the Japan Aerospace Exploration Agency (JAXA), has a rich history and a promising future. Established in 2003 through the merger of three separate organizations, JAXA is responsible for all civilian space activities in Japan. The origins of Japan’s space endeavors date back to the mid-1950s with the launch of the Pencil Rocket, a small experimental rocket developed by Hideo Itokawa and his team at the University of Tokyo. Over the decades, Japan’s capabilities have grown significantly, leading to the development of advanced rockets like the H-IIA and H-IIB, which are used for satellite launches and other missions. One of JAXA’s notable achievements is its contribution to the International Space Station (ISS). The Japanese Experiment Module, known as “Kibo,†is the largest module on the ISS and serves as a laboratory for various scientific experiments. Additionally, JAXA’s HTV (H-II Transfer Vehicle), nicknamed “Kounotori,†has been crucial for delivering supplies to the ISS. Japan has also made significant strides in planetary exploration. The Hayabusa missions, which aimed to collect samples from asteroids, have been particularly successful. Hayabusa, launched in 2014, returned samples from the asteroid Ryugu in 2020, providing valuable insights into the early solar system. Looking ahead, JAXA is involved in ambitious projects such as the Lunar Polar Exploration Mission (LUPEX) in collaboration with India, and the Martian Moons exploration (MMX) mission, which aims to explore the moons of Mars. These initiatives have contributed greatly to global scientific knowledge.
